Ukraine Files Lawsuit Against Russia in International Court Over Russia’s Claim Ukraine Is Committing ‘Genocide’

Ukraine has officially filed a lawsuit against the Russian Federation in the UN International Court of Justice in The Hague.

Reporting from Ukrainian news agency, Ukrinform:

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ky announced this on Twitter, Ukrinform reports.

“Ukraine has submitted its application against Russia to the ICJ. Russia must be held accountable for manipulating the notion of genocide to justify aggression,” Zelensky said.

He called on the court to order Russia to cease military activity now and expect trials to start next week.

The war in Ukraine has been going on for four days. On February 24, Russian President Vladimir Putin announced the beginning of an invasion of Ukraine. Martial law was imposed. Zelensky signed a decree on general mobilization.

From the Ukrainian government:

Ukraine filed a case against the Russian Federation at the International Court of Justice, and a request for the Court to issue an order of provisional measures against Russia.  Ukraine seeks an emergency hearing and an order by the Court that Russia must cease its unlawful attack on Ukraine.  Russia will have to answer for its behavior at the World Court in the Hague.

The Court has jurisdiction to hear Ukraine’s case, and to order emergency measures, on the basis of the Convention on the Prevention and Punishment of the Crime of Genocide (“Genocide Convention”).  The Genocide Convention is one of the most important international treaties, drafted in response to the horrors of World War II and the Holocaust.  Russia, however, has twisted the concept of genocide, and perverted the solemn treaty obligation to prevent and punish genocide.  It has made an absurd and unfounded claim of alledged genocide as a justification and pretext for its own aggression against Ukraine and violation of the sovereignty and human rights of the Ukrainian People.  

Ukraine’s case before the ICJ will establish that Russia’s aggression against Ukraine is based on a lie and a gross violation of international law, and must be stopped.
